Documents required for business trips
The main document on the basis of which the business trip is carried out is an order. This document is mandatory. To prepare it, you can use a unified T-9A form or your own template. The order usually indicates the name and position of the employee, describe where he is sent, and how much the business trip will last.
Another document mandatory for registration of a business trip is an advance report. It is composed after the completion of the business trip in order to report on the costs covered by the company to complete the service assignment.
The document includes the name of the organization, number, date, as well as the unit and position of the employee. In addition, they indicate the reason for the preparation of the report – this is a business trip – and prescribe the amounts of the issued advance and actual costs.
Documents are also applied to the advance report to confirm the costs of accommodation, travel, etc.
Optional closing documents
A few years ago, the number of mandatory documents for the design of the business trip included an official task (T-10A form). At the moment, it is not necessary to draw up this document, but some companies still make it up for the convenience of reporting. At the same time, one of the tasks is a report on its implementation, the employee is filled out after returning from the trip
A travel certificate since 2015 is not a mandatory document. However, no one forbids him to compose. If the document is drawn up, then at each destination the employee puts a note into it on the date and time of arrival, and the receiving party certifies them with a signature and seal (if possible).
